Photo: Moment RFA 19-year-old college student in the UK underwent multiple amputations after mistaking deadly meningitis for the flu, PEOPLE reports.
Moponda initially brushed off her symptoms, like coughing and fatigue, as a typical cold and delayed going to the doctor.
After telling a friend that she felt like she was “going to die,” Moponda stopped responding to calls and messages.
Moponda had to undergo finger amputation in December before both her legs were removed below the knee in January 2025.
“Basically, my legs had died because of a lack of blood going to them,” Moponda said.
